ISL 2024-25: Mumbai City faces depleted East Bengal with hopes to continue winning run

Mumbai City FC would try to keep her winning streak and stay in the play-off qualification zone, when on Friday he is the host of Bengal Wschodni in the Super League (ISL) Indian match in Bombay.

The islanders returned to victory with a triumph 3: 0 against Mohammedan Sporting last week and are currently sixth place with 27 points at seven wins and six draws.

The Petr Kratky Team team has a chance to make a double league for the second time over the Red & Gold brigade, winning the opposite of 3-2.

However, Mumbai City did not defeat East Bengal at home, even unable to find the back of the net in both previous meetings, losing and drawing once.

However, Bengal Wschodni tried to find feet on the road this season. He won only once in the last eight away matches, drawing once and losing six times.

However, in the last match of Bengal Wschodni he saw him win 2: 1 from Kerala Blasters when he scored drought at the goal in two matches.

Currently, the Red-Gold Brigade is on the 11th place in the Table of Points. He won and drew once in the previous five matches, losing three times and has 17 points on so many games.

Holding the sixth islanders with 10 points, this is a chance for Eastern Bengal to reduce the gap in a direct competition, and then hope for a victorious run to be late at the play-off (ending in the upper part).

The main coach of Mumbai City, Petry Kratky, said that he believes that the team is becoming better with every match.

“We think that we become stronger and better, which is very important to me as a trainer. I am very pleased with where we are and how we are doing – he said.

The coach of Eastern Bengal Oscar Bruzon emphasized the unpredictability of every game at ISL.

“One of the good things at ISL is that each game is very tight. All compositions are very balanced. You can never predict which team will win, which match – he said.

Two teams faced ISL nine times. Mumbai City won six matches, while Bengal Wschodni won twice.
